Breathwork, Hydration, and Stress Management Techniques
Effective recovery is not only about sleep, nutrition, and movement; it also relies on managing stress and optimizing daily routines. Breathwork has emerged as a powerful tool for regulating the nervous system, lowering cortisol levels, and improving cardiovascular efficiency. A stress recovery assessment can reveal how an individual’s autonomic system responds to stress, enabling the selection of specific breathing techniques, such as diaphragmatic breathing, box breathing, or guided paced breathing, to accelerate recovery and reduce physiological strain.
Hydration is frequently overlooked in recovery planning. Adequate hydration supports cellular function, metabolic efficiency, and the body’s natural detoxification processes. Personalized assessments identify individuals with higher fluid requirements or subtle signs of dehydration, allowing for targeted hydration strategies that complement nutrition and exercise routines.
